Why 2-3 hours visit duration is ideal for couple trip: Enough time to stroll, visit the TV Tower and enjoy a light-up or beer garden without rushing.
Flower-lined walk:
Walk hand-in-hand along the 1.5 km boulevard from Nishi 2–7 Chome.
Tip: Visit after sunrise to see morning dew on lilacs and avoid crowds.
Sapporo TV Tower observatory:
Take the elevator up to the 90 m deck for 360° city views.
Tip: Buy a day-and-night ticket (¥1,500 per adult) to catch sunset and city lights.
White Illumination light walk:
Stroll through Nishi 1–6 Chome after dusk during November–December.
Tip: Wear warm layers and follow the themed route for best photo spots.
Summer Beer Garden date:
From mid-July to mid-August, blocks 5–11 host the Odori Beer Garden.
Tip: Reserve “hospitality seats” online for a 2-hour course and skip the queue.

Late April–mid October see seasonal flowerbeds and fountains. Mid-July–mid-August enjoy the beer garden. Mid-November–Dec 25 walk under sparkly lights. February hosts snow sculptures at the Snow Festival.
